Two Ontario surgery center employees who allegedly assaulted federal agents were indicted on Wednesday, the U.S. Department of Justice said in a news release.
Highland resident Jose de Jesus Ortega, 38, and Corona resident Danielle Nadine Davila, 33, are charged with one felony count of assaulting, resisting and impeding a federal officer.
